Hot water tanks are reliable and efficient water heating systems designed to store and supply hot water on demand for residential use. Unlike tankless water heaters, which heat water as it is needed, hot water tanks maintain a constant supply of heated water, ensuring that it’s always available when required. These systems are ideal for larger households or properties with multiple bathrooms, where simultaneous water usage is common. Hot water tanks are available in gas, electric, and hybrid models, providing flexibility based on energy availability and efficiency preferences.

Types of Hot Water Tanks
Hot water tanks come in three main types, each with unique benefits depending on your home’s requirements:
1. Gas Hot Water Tanks
✔ Heats water faster than electric models, making them ideal for larger households.
✔ More cost-effective in areas with access to natural gas.
✔ Offers high energy efficiency with advanced burner technology.
2. Electric Hot Water Tanks
✔ Easier to install and requires no venting, making them ideal for smaller spaces.
✔ Typically have lower upfront costs, though energy consumption may be higher.
✔ Reliable performance with high-efficiency heating elements.
3. Hybrid (Heat Pump) Water Heaters
✔ Uses heat pump technology to extract warmth from surrounding air, reducing energy use.
✔ Highly energy-efficient, saving up to 60% on electricity bills.
✔ Eco-friendly option with lower carbon footprint compared to traditional models.
Choosing the Right Hot Water Tank
Selecting the best hot water tank depends on factors such as household size, daily water usage, energy availability, and budget. A larger-capacity tank (50-80 gallons) is ideal for families with multiple users, while smaller tanks (30-40 gallons) are sufficient for apartments and low-demand households. Hybrid models are a great choice for those looking to maximize energy savings and sustainability.
